☐ Mail room relocation — day one. The old mail room on the ground floor of Verrow House is closed. All parcels, tools, and contractor deliveries now go to Room 014 behind the loading bay. Do not leave anything in the old corridor; it is an active work zone. Sign the delivery log on arrival. Site escort not required for drop-offs under ten minutes. Report damaged packaging to the duty supervisor before leaving. The Room 014 keypad accepts the following entry code.

badge for kawif-yahif: bdg-CLP-1

**Ticket: Config drift on planner nodes**

The Vexim query service is showing the planner regression again on nodes 3 and 7, but not elsewhere. Diffing the fleet shows those two hosts kept last quarter's cost-model overrides after the hotfix rollback. This explains the intermittent slow joins paged overnight. Until the fleet is re-synced, treat any planner alert from those hosts as drift-related. The intended settings are these.

settings of fafog-haduf:
ZORIX_PIN=4648
ZORIX_METRICS_HOST=metrics.zorix.paliqsys.corp
ZORIX_LOG_LEVEL=info
ZORIX_TENANT=druix

Team — DR drill for Gridwell's report builder is Thursday. Focus: verifying sort stability after restore. Known issue: tie-breaking on secondary columns drifts if the index rebuild runs before the collation fix. Steps: snapshot, restore to the Fenley cluster, run the stable-sort regression pack, compare checksums. To unlock the drill restore vault, use the passphrase printed directly below.

vault phrase of tadug-tajep = praion-sordor-zoreth-ralir-belius